Why are my Texas DBTs climbing out of my pond and burying themselves in a nearby land area? The turtles are 1 year old, the pond water quality is good, the temps here in N.Dallas have been nice, 70F to 92F. the turtles appear in good condition. Is this typical behavior and if so when will they return to the pond? Ed in Dallas
